Output 589de2d7687429c001a7c7886a813dd4b20ee0c67f228bb7aaedafcc666ab338:106

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 835e0321b5f48905d066c051f87c03fb27f52faba4e437001484e1a31a4e1b9b
address
bc1psd0qxgd47jyst5rxcpglslqrlvnl2tat5njrwqq5sns6xxjwrwds499kk0
transaction
589de2d7687429c001a7c7886a813dd4b20ee0c67f228bb7aaedafcc666ab338
spent
true